Output ed346b92852903d1854ef8ed0ff8689ed4cfd6cd6315e7f44a1d2c6b268d86bf:2

value
604876
script pubkey
OP_0 OP_PUSHBYTES_20 073412b158f2bf37ea84358119f96ee24fc5dea3
address
tb1qqu6p9v2c72ln065yxkq3n7twuf8uth4rp9mg3r
transaction
ed346b92852903d1854ef8ed0ff8689ed4cfd6cd6315e7f44a1d2c6b268d86bf
confirmations
68123
spent
true